Project Stonewick, the internal migration of our scheduling tools to the Caldera platform, is now four months behind the original timeline. Root causes include underestimated data-cleanup effort and the mid-year departure of two senior engineers. A revised plan adds a dedicated integration team and moves the cutover to early next year. Branch managers should continue using the legacy system and avoid local workarounds. The delay has implications for next year's roadmap, which is outlined confidentially below.

internal memo for kahop-yajof: The steering committee signed off on a budget of $12.6 million for Project Jorwyn. The renewal with Quenoxox Logistics closes at $16.8 million a year, 48 percent above the last contract.

**Ticket #—: Mail room relocation, Hatterly Building**

The mail room moves from ground floor to Level 2 this weekend. Night shift: please redirect any couriers to the Level 2 hatch from Saturday onward. The old room will be locked and alarmed once Vendace Movers finish. Access to the new room requires the door code below.

turnstile pass: bdg-QZV-3

## Order Cutoff Rule — Millbrand Ovenworks

New folks: the cutoff service locks next-day custom orders at a fixed hour so the overnight bake plan can be generated. Orders arriving after cutoff roll to the following bake day automatically; never override this manually, as the prep roster is already scheduled. Holiday calendars shift the cutoff earlier. The active cutoff settings are as follows.

deployment values, kajep-kageg:
[praix]
host = praix.paliqcorp.corp
user = praix_svc
database = praix_prod

**Q: Why does LiftSim's dispatch queue use a custom heap instead of the standard library?**

The stdlib heap reorders equal-priority hall calls, which breaks determinism in replay tests. Our heap is insertion-stable. Don't "simplify" it during review — the replay suite will fail silently on some seeds. See `docs/determinism.md` for the full rationale. Questions about the heap invariants go to the sim-core maintainer.

escalation mailbox, hahog-yahop: wenox.ralix.ralax@qirvandata.local